CVC Capital, Warburg Pincus in fray for digital tech services firm TO THE NEW

Private equity firms have been active in the IT and technology services space in 2023, including deals like Warburg Pincus-Everise and Apax Partners-IBS Software

Binding bids are expected in the next 2-3 weeks. The expectation is that the deal should value the company in the range of $750 - $850 million

A clutch of around four bidders, including private equity funds and strategic players, have been shortlisted for the next stage in the ongoing sale of a majority stake in digital technology services company TO THE NEW, multiple industry sources in the know told Moneycontrol.

"CVC Capital, Warburg Pincus and two global strategic players have been picked after the initial round of bids for the due diligence stage," one of the persons in the know told Moneycontrol.

Singapore-headquartered TO THE NEW was established by four Indian entrepreneurs in 2008.

"The firm plays in the very attractive segment of cloud services and a lot of players are looking to invest and acquire capabilities in this space. The founders feel if they align with someone, the firm can be on a higher growth trajectory," a second person told Moneycontrol.

According to a third person familiar with ongoing negotiations: "Binding bids are expected in the next 2-3 weeks. The expectation is that the deal should value the company in the range of $750 - $850 million, though that figure may vary depending on diligence and final stage negotiations."

"For a PE player, this represents a platform, behind which they can do bolt-on acquisitions. Lincoln International is the sell-side advisor on the deal," a fourth person elaborated.

All the four persons above spoke to Moneycontrol on the condition of anonymity.

In response to an email query, TO THE NEW Co-Founder and CEO Deepak Mittal said: "We would refrain from commenting on this."

Queries sent to CVC Capital, Warburg Pincus and Lincoln International were left unanswered at the time of publishing this article.

Know more about the target: TO THE NEW

TO THE NEW provides product engineering, Cloud and FinOps services to enterprises, SaaS (Software as a Service), ISVs (independent software vendors) and consumer tech companies.

As per its website, the firm has more than 2,500 employees, spread across six locations - Singapore, New Delhi, Dehradun, Dubai, New Jersey and Sydney catering to over 300 customers in the America's, EMEA region (Europe, Middle East and Africa), APAC ( Asia Pacific Region) and India.

Its Indian customers include IndiGo, HDFC Mutual Fund, Tata Play, Maruti Suzuki, Fortis, SonyLiv, Zepto and Lenskart, according to the website.

According to CEO Mittal's Linkedin profile, "TO THE NEW also leverages its deep partnership with all the leading hyperscalers like AWS (Premier Partner), Azure, and GCP to provide end-to-end cloud professional and managed services to its customers.”

The firm has a cloud cost optimization and FinOps solution called Cloud Keeper which claims to offer instant and guaranteed savings of upto 25 percent on the entire cloud bill.

Private equity firms have been active in the IT and technology services space in 2023.

In October, Warburg Pincus announced an investment in healthcare services outsourcing firm Everise as part of which existing investor Everstone Group made an exit.

In May, private equity firm Apax Partners acquired travel and logistics SaaS firm IBS Software for $450 million.
